Depends where the cable is broken. If it’s broken at the lever inside the car, or at the latch.

If it’s broken at the lever under dash then you can get to it just by removing the plastic trim around the lever. Or you can get to it by removing the plastic liner under the driver’s fender (Hence my “relocating the hood release cable” writeup inthe teg tips.) but to open it from unde the fender, you need to cut the cable so you can get to and pull the metal cable inside the sleeve.

I believe if you raise the car on a lift, you could climb under it and reach up between the manifold and radiator and pop the latch with your fingers or a clothes hanger bent into the right shape hook. but you’d probably have to look at another teg (one with a hood that opens) so you see the little lever that the cable pulls on. that way you know what you are feeling for and which way to pull it.
